Tense Match in La Louvière Ends in Draw
La Louvière, Belgium – A tense encounter at the Easi Arena between RAAL La Louvière and Charleroi culminated in a draw, in a match corresponding to the third matchday of the Jupiler Pro League. Possession was clearly in favor of Charleroi, with 67%, compared to La Louvière’s 33%. However, the score remained tied.
An unfortunate own goal by E. Camara in the 16th minute put RAAL La Louvière ahead, but the joy was short-lived. The home team, although with less possession, tried to take advantage of their opportunities, accumulating 11 shots, although only two found the target. Charleroi also totaled 11 shots, but only three were on target.
The match was fiercely contested and marked by several yellow cards for RAAL La Louvière, including O. Mendy, S. Lahssaini, and M. Guindo. Furthermore, a goal by M. Guindo was disallowed for offside in the 59th minute, which increased frustration for the home team. Despite the efforts of both teams, the score did not change further, and the match ended in a draw. Referee Nicolas Laforge kept a firm grip on the match in this Belgian clash.
